Crawl Space Remediation in Summerville, SC
Crawl space remediation services focus on improving the condition of the area beneath a home’s main level, addressing issues like moisture, mold, pests, and structural concerns. Projects typically involve moisture control, mold removal, pest exclusion, insulation repair or replacement, and vapor barrier installation to create a healthier and more stable foundation. Homeowners often request this service when noticing musty odors, increased humidity, or visible signs of water damage and mold, aiming to prevent further deterioration and protect indoor air quality.
Before requesting crawl space remediation, property owners usually want to understand the extent of any damage or contamination, the types of repairs needed, and how the work will improve the space’s condition. It’s important to consider the current state of insulation, ventilation, and moisture levels, as well as any existing pest problems. Clear communication about these concerns helps ensure the remediation process effectively addresses the specific issues present and results in a healthier, more durable crawl space.

Crawl Space Moisture Control
Addressing excess humidity helps prevent mold growth and structural damage in homes around summerville.
Foundation And Structural Support
Proper remediation reinforces the foundation and prevents issues caused by wood rot and pest infestations.
Vapor Barrier Installation
Sealing the crawl space with a vapor barrier reduces moisture infiltration and improves indoor air quality.

Crawl Space Remediation Questions
What is crawl space remediation? It involves addressing issues like moisture, mold, pests, and structural damage in the crawl space to improve home safety and durability.
What problems can crawl space remediation fix? It can resolve excess moisture, mold growth, pest infestations, and wood rot that may affect the home's foundation and indoor air quality.
How does crawl space remediation benefit homeowners? It helps prevent structural damage, reduces indoor humidity, and improves overall home health and safety.
What signs indicate a need for crawl space remediation? Signs include musty odors, visible mold, standing water, or pest activity under the home.
